The theoretical and experimental investigations on ground erosion, carried out in connection with the development of the V/STOL transport aircraft Do 31, are summarized. A mobile test rig with a one stream Orenda 14 jet engine was developed for the experiments. The resistance, which is dependent on jet intensity, was tested of wet and dry grassland at Memmingen and Oberpfaffenhofen, conventional concrete, special concrete, asphalt, synthetic coating, and ground reinforced by water-glass. The movement of particles in the wall jet was also investigated. Reduction of the lift jet intensity and special methods of STOL to avoid ground erosion are considered. (Author)
